- the present invention relates to the technical field of energy storage, and more specifically, relates to an energy storage battery system.
- the heat dissipation method of the energy storage battery system is developing from the air-cooled heat dissipation method of the air conditioner to the liquid cooling heat dissipation method.
- the battery In the liquid cooling heat dissipation method, the battery relies on the coolant inside the liquid cooling pipeline to remove heat, and the thermal management efficiency is higher.
- energy storage battery systems are mostly box-type structures, and battery clusters and other components are arranged in containers or outdoor cabinets.
- the protection level of the casing is required to be high, generally IP54 and above.
- IP54 the protection level of the casing
- the capacity of the shell is relatively fixed and in a sealed state, which is not convenient for flexible deployment on the project site.
- both the shell and the battery are of high protection level, the processing is complicated, the cost is high, and it is not conducive to the cooling of the battery after thermal runaway. Explosion-proof treatment.
- the object of the present invention is to provide an energy storage battery system.
- the structural design of the energy storage battery system can effectively realize flexible changes in the number and location of battery modules, which is conducive to flexible deployment on the project site.

- the energy storage battery system provided by the present invention includes a liquid cooling unit 2 , a support structure and multiple battery modules 3 .
- the liquid cooling unit 2 has a cooling liquid outlet and a cooling liquid inlet, and the cooling liquid enters the liquid cooling unit 2 through the cooling liquid inlet of the liquid cooling unit 2 .
- the liquid cooling unit 2 refrigerates the cooling liquid to reduce the temperature of the cooling liquid entering the liquid cooling unit 2 , and the refrigerated cooling liquid is discharged through the cooling liquid outlet of the liquid cooling unit 2 .
- At least part of the support structure is open, that is, the support structure has a deployment hole, and the battery module can pass through the deployment hole to enter and exit the support structure.
- the inside of the support structure has a first cooling liquid channel 11 and a second cooling liquid channel 12, that is, the inside of the support structure is prefabricated with the first cooling liquid channel 11 and the second cooling liquid channel 12, and only the first cooling liquid channel 11 and the second cooling liquid channel.
- the inlet and outlet of the fluid channel 12 are exposed on the surface of the support structure.
- the inlet of the first cooling liquid passage 11 communicates with the cooling liquid outlet of the liquid cooling unit 2
- the outlet of the second cooling liquid passage communicates with the cooling liquid inlet of the liquid cooling unit 2 .
- the support structure may include a support beam, and the battery module 3 is fixedly connected to the support beam.
- Each battery module 3 has a heat exchanger inside, the coolant inlet of the heat exchanger communicates with the outlet of the first coolant channel 11, the coolant outlet of the heat exchanger communicates with the inlet of the second coolant channel, and the coolant from the liquid cooling
- the cooling liquid flowing out of the unit 2 passes through the first cooling liquid channel 11 , the heat exchanger of the battery module 3 and the second cooling liquid channel 12 in turn, and then flows back to the liquid cooling unit 2 .
- the cooling liquid flows through the heat exchanger of the battery module 3, it takes away the heat inside the battery module 3, so as to realize the heat dissipation of the battery.
- the heat exchangers of multiple battery modules 3 can be connected in parallel or in series, or the heat exchangers in some battery modules 3 can be connected in series first and then connected in parallel with the heat exchangers in the rest of the battery modules 3 .
- the casing 8 of the battery module 3 is a waterproof and dustproof casing. Specifically, the protection level of the casing 8 of the battery module 3 is IP54 and above.
- a first cooling liquid channel 11 and a second cooling liquid channel 12 are provided inside the support structure, through which the liquid cooling unit 2 and the The heat exchanger of the battery module 3 is connected, so that the cooling liquid flowing out from the liquid cooling unit 2 passes through the first cooling liquid channel 11, the heat exchanger of the battery module 3 and the second cooling liquid channel 12 in sequence, and then returns to the liquid cooling unit.
- the unit 2 realizes the heat dissipation of the battery.
- the battery module 3 can pass through
- the adjustment holes are used to enter and exit the support structure, so that the number and position of the battery modules 3 can be adjusted through the adjustment holes of the support structure to adapt to the on-site project, which is conducive to flexible deployment on the project site.

- the energy storage battery system further includes any one or more of the battery management module 5 and the power conversion unit 4 fixed on the support structure.
- the battery management module 5, the power conversion unit 4 and the battery module 3 are mutually independent components, and the battery management module 5, the power conversion unit 4 and the battery module 3 are integrated on one or more supporting structures, which is more convenient for management ,transportation.
- the battery management module 5 is mainly used to control the on-off of the battery cluster, monitor and manage the state of the battery cluster.
- the casings 8 of the temperature control unit, the battery management module 5 and the power conversion unit 4 are all dustproof and waterproof casings, and the protection level of the dustproof and waterproof casings is IP54 and above.

- the liquid cooling unit 2 communicates with both the first cooling liquid channel 11 and the second cooling liquid channel 12 of the multiple supporting structures.
- the liquid cooling unit 2 can supply cooling liquid to multiple battery clusters fixed on the support structure, so that multiple battery clusters can share one liquid cooling unit 2 , which reduces the cost and simplifies the structure.
- the number of support structures is multiple.
- the energy storage system also includes a fire fighting unit 7.
- the fire fighting unit 7 includes multiple parallel fire extinguishing pipelines and multiple parallel alarm detection modules.
- the multiple fire extinguishing pipelines are respectively used to supply fire extinguishing to the battery clusters in multiple support structures. medium. Specifically, when a fire occurs in the battery cluster, the fire extinguishing medium is supplied to the inside of the battery cluster to realize fire extinguishing.
- the plurality of alarm detection modules are respectively used to detect whether there is fire in the battery clusters in the plurality of support structures and to give an alarm when fire occurs. Specifically, the alarm detection module detects a fire in the battery cluster and alarms to prompt the staff. With this arrangement, multiple battery clusters share one firefighting unit 7, which reduces the cost and simplifies the structure.
- the fire extinguishing medium can be water, fine water mist, perfluorohexanone, heptafluoropropane or aerosol, which is not limited here.
- the casing 8 of the battery module 3 may have a vacuum cavity 81 inside or an insulating layer inside the casing 8 of the battery module 3 .
- the casing 8 of the battery module 3 is provided with a pressure relief port and a pressure limiting valve arranged at the pressure relief port.
- the pressure in the casing 8 of the battery module 3 reaches a preset value, the pressure can be released through the pressure limiting valve.
